Output e29417cf75bb5c83f4a2e51cce9812dfa00ee8d813fc40887ec9f50eca9b7186:0

value
138123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 952800b079dee93f743d988d9d96d70a7696fc7d OP_EQUAL
address
3FHgXZZs1geCxWv2EZgdq2Uj5zJz1EiGSx
transaction
e29417cf75bb5c83f4a2e51cce9812dfa00ee8d813fc40887ec9f50eca9b7186
confirmations
357704
spent
true